The Door At The End Of The Hallway
Summary: A young man named Jeremy has just gotten his degree in literature, and is ready to start writing. So, he moves to New York, and finds that the real world is a much different place than his sleepy little home town. Unable to afford the kind of home he wanted, he settles for a cheap tenement. Yet, once he moves in, he finds a few surprises waiting for him. An oddly modern suite to live in, a mysterious and unsettling old woman, and a door that holds a few secrets of it's own. As time goes on, Jeremy is no longer sure what is really happening, or what is just his fevered imagination.
